我正在处理自动分片,我曾经问过分片A中的数据是否会在分片B中可用,.They已经回答说分片A中的数据将不会在分片B中可用,.In这种情况下,自动故障转移是如何工作的?例如,我有3个分片,其中一个分片出现故障,那么我们可以从其他分片访问数据,对吧?如果每个分片中的数据是不同的,那么我们如何访问data?...Anyone可以解释this..Plz..
发布于 2011-02-02 18:46:21
分片与故障转移无关,而是与可伸缩性有关。使用副本集实现故障切换。即每个分片作为多节点副本集运行,当主节点故障时,在从节点中选举新的主节点。
看起来是这样的:http://www.infoq.com/resource/news/2010/08/MongoDB-1.6/en/resources/mongodb2.png
https://stackoverflow.com/questions/4872611
复制相似问题